If you had read the preceding posts you would know how and why the exemption certificate works as it does, the most likely outcome of a campaign for more caravans on CL's is that the site planning exemption concession would be withdrawn altogether.

I also agree with this conclusion that any concerted effort to change our very valuable concession would be simply to lose it. There is already a simple route to getting a greater allowance where it is justifiable, apply for the releavant planning permission. Unless there is a good reason why you should not get it it has to be granted.

Why should we be exempt of meeting planning laws that others have to meet? I am sure that would be the view the legislators would take if we rock the boat. on this one.
